'use strict'
const Recipe = use('App/Models/Recipe');
const Helpers = use('Helpers')
const Drive = use('Drive')
const fetch = require('node-fetch');
const targz = require('targz');
const path = require('path');
const fs = require('fs-extra');
const compress = (src, dest) => {
return new Promise((resolve, reject) => {
targz.compress({
src,
dest
}, function (err) {
if (err) {
reject(err);
} else {
resolve(dest);
}
});
})
}
class RecipeController {
// List official and custom recipes
async list({
response
}) {
const officialRecipes = JSON.parse(await (await fetch('https://api.franzinfra.com/v1/recipes')).text());
const customRecipesArray = (await Recipe.all()).rows;
const customRecipes = customRecipesArray.map(recipe => ({
"id": recipe.recipeId,
"name": recipe.name,
...JSON.parse(recipe.data)
}))
const recipes = [
...officialRecipes,
...customRecipes,
]
return response.send(recipes)
}
// Create a new recipe using the new.html page
async create({
request,
response
}) {
const data = request.all();
if (!data.id) {
return response.send('Please provide an ID');
}
// Check for invalid characters
if (/\.{1,}/.test(data.id) || /\/{1,}/.test(data.id)) {
return response.send('Invalid recipe name. Your recipe name may not contain "." or "/"');
}
// Clear temporary recipe folder
await fs.emptyDir(Helpers.tmpPath('recipe'));
// Move uploaded files to temporary path
const files = request.file('files')
await files.moveAll(Helpers.tmpPath('recipe'))
// Compress files to .tar.gz file
const source = Helpers.tmpPath('recipe');
const destination = path.join(Helpers.appRoot(), '/recipes/' + data.id + '.tar.gz');
console.log('a', source, destination)
compress(
source,
destination
);
// Create recipe in db
await Recipe.create({
name: data.name,
recipeId: data.id,
data: JSON.stringify({
"author": data.author,
"featured": false,
"version": "1.0.0",
"icons": {
"png": data.png,
"svg": data.svg
}
})
})
return response.send('Created new recipe')
}
// Search official and custom recipes
async search({
request,
response
}) {
const needle = request.input('needle')
// Get results
const remoteResults = JSON.parse(await (await fetch('https://api.franzinfra.com/v1/recipes/search?needle=' + needle)).text());
const localResultsArray = (await Recipe.query().where('name', 'LIKE', '%' + needle + '%').fetch()).toJSON();
const localResults = localResultsArray.map(recipe => ({
"id": recipe.recipeId,
"name": recipe.name,
...JSON.parse(recipe.data)
}))
const results = [
...localResults,
...remoteResults,
]
return response.send(results);
}
// Download a recipe
async download({
request,
response,
params
}) {
const service = params.recipe;
// Check for invalid characters
if (/\.{1,}/.test(service) || /\/{1,}/.test(service)) {
return response.send('Invalid recipe name');
}
// Check if recipe exists in recipes folder
if (await Drive.exists(service + '.tar.gz')) {
response.send(await Drive.get(service + '.tar.gz'))
} else {
response.redirect('https://api.franzinfra.com/v1/recipes/download/' + service)
}
}
}
module.exports = RecipeController
